Hello,
have you ever been able to use Camera Raw with these cameras? Your Canon Eos 5D Mark 3 requires Camera Raw 7.1 at a minimum. The G9 requires Camera Raw 4.3 and the G12 requires camera raw 6.3. Photoshop CS5 comes with Camera Raw 6.0 and is upgradeable to 6.7. Therefore your Eos 5D will not work, your G9 will work and with the update so should your G12. You can get the update to Camera Raw 6.7 at the link below. Your G9 and G12 should then work.
Adobe Camera Raw 6.7 and DNG Convertor 6.7 Now Available on Adobe.com
Your Eos 5D requires a later version of Photoshop to work, but Adobe only sell Creative Cloud subscriptions now. Therefore you must use a piece of alternative software called a Digital Negative Converter with your 5D. Just download from the link below

Actually you probably just need to upgrade your camera raw plugin to version 6.7
Camera raw 6.7 and 7.1 were out around the same time and both supported the Canon EOS 5D Mark III
Seems to me the adobe camera raw camera support page used to note that, but doesn't anymore.
When you reinstall or install on a new drive you lose all the updates and return to the first cs5 version12.0.
The most updated photoshop cs5 is 12.0.4
